What Are Lab Cultivated Diamonds?

Lab cultivated diamonds are real diamonds created using advanced technology that replicates the natural diamond-growing process. Just like diamonds formed underground over billions of years, lab-grown diamonds are made of pure carbon arranged in a crystal structure.

There are two primary methods used to create them:

  • High Pressure High Temperature (HPHT): Mimics the intense heat and pressure conditions found in the Earth’s mantle.

  • Chemical Vapor Deposition (CVD): Uses a carbon-rich gas in a vacuum chamber to form diamond crystals layer by layer.

The result? A diamond that is chemically, physically, and optically identical to a mined diamond—often indistinguishable without specialized equipment.

Are Lab Cultivated Diamonds Real?

Yes. Lab cultivated diamonds are 100% real diamonds. They are not imitations like cubic zirconia or moissanite. In fact, even professional gemologists need specialized tools to distinguish them from mined diamonds.

They possess:

  • Hardness: 10 on the Mohs scale (same as natural diamonds)

  • Refractive Index: 2.42 (same sparkle and brilliance)

  • Thermal Conductivity: Identical to earth-mined diamonds

Shopping Tips: Buying Lab Cultivated Diamonds Online

Here’s what to consider when buying lab-grown diamonds from online or retail stores:

  • Check Certification: Always buy diamonds that come with a grading report from a trusted lab like IGI or GIA.

  • Understand the 4Cs: Cut, Color, Clarity, and Carat weight are just as important in lab diamonds as they are in mined ones.

  • Compare Prices: Since pricing can vary, explore multiple sellers to get the best value.

  • Choose a Trusted Retailer: Look for established jewelers with transparent sourcing, return policies, and strong customer reviews.

  • Explore Settings: Lab diamonds are compatible with all types of metal settings including platinum, white gold, yellow gold, and rose gold.
